THE BIG BULKERS HAVE IN FACT WITNESSED SIGNIFICANT IMPROVEMENTS IN BOTH BASINS
The BDI continues to gain back some of the lost ground, although in reality there isn't a lot to celebrate about, as the increase of the BDI this week was mostly the result of Capes strengthening. It is definitely too early to make any predictions in relation to the developments in Ukraine but we already witnessed sentiment being affected as uncertainty is sometimes almost as bad as negative news themselves. The Russian President said today that his country isn't considering adding Crimea to Russia, which calmed markets a bit, so we are hoping that the situation wont escalate further.
The Capesize segment was the strongest link this past week, with the BCI climbing to over 2,000 points.
The big bulkers have in fact witnessed significant improvements in both basins, with rates in Pacific enjoying the strong presence of mining majors. The Atlantic Panamax business struggled close to the end of the week, as post Lunar Year ballasters from the Pacific have now arrived and little new business was seen for tonnage open on the Continent or in the Med. There were talks of some fresh inquiry from East Coast South America, with rates trending sideways on shorter tonnage list s and fewer ballasters in transit. The Pacific basin was under pressure, with rates easing for trips via Indonesia and Nopac rounds.
The performance of rates for the smaller size segments has remained overall steady in both basins, with Supra tonnage feeling some pressure from gathering ballasters in the U SG region, which nevertheless is expected to ease this current week.
